New Delhi, Feb 4 (IANS) Delhi saw a pleasant Wednesday with the maximum temperature recorded two notches below the season's average at 20.6 degrees Celsius. The Met department forecast a similar Thursday.
The minimum temperature Wednesday was three notches above the season's average at 11.3 degrees Celsius, said an official with the India Meteorological Department.
After fog in the morning Thursday, the sky will clear up later in the day, the official said.
Thursday's maximum and minimum temperatures are likely to hover around 20 and 10 degrees Celsius, respectively.
